PrinciplesLight Emission Principle: The core of the LED chips inside the tube consists of a PN junction made of semiconductor materials. When current passes through the LED chips, electrons and holes recombine at the PN junction, releasing energy in the form of photons to produce light. The high electro-optical conversion efficiency of LED chips means most electrical energy is directly converted into light energy, minimizing heat loss, which is a key factor in its high luminous efficacy.Radar Sensing Principle: The tube is equipped with a built-in millimeter-wave radar sensor that operates based on the Doppler effect. The radar sensor continuously emits high-frequency microwave signals and receives reflected signals. When a vehicle or pedestrian enters the radar sensing area, the movement of the target object causes a change in the frequency of the reflected signal. The sensor detects this frequency change, processes it through an intelligent recognition circuit, and transmits the signal to the lamp's driver circuit, prompting the tube to quickly switch from low-power sleep mode to full-power operation for automatic illumination. After the target object leaves the sensing area, the tube automatically returns to low-power sleep mode after a delay of 15–60 seconds (adjustable as needed), saving energy.III. Product Description: For casting mold making, use white liquid mold silicone with a 100:2 ratio of silicone rubber to curing agent. Contact the factory to order: 13662816580, Ms. Chen.Preparation: Clean the master mold thoroughly and apply a release agent to ensure the surface is free from oil, dust, and other impurities, allowing the silicone to adhere properly. Choose the appropriate mold-making method, such as brushing or pouring, based on requirements, and prepare necessary tools like mixing containers, stirring rods, and a vacuum chamber.Mixing: Accurately measure the silicone and curing agent according to the product instructions. Typically, the curing ratio for condensation-type mold silicone is 100:2-3, while for addition-type AB silicone, it is 1:12. Pour both into a mixing container and stir quickly to ensure thorough blending of the curing agent and silicone.Deaeration: Air bubbles may form during mixing and require vacuum deaeration. Place the silicone in a vacuum chamber and evacuate until all bubbles are expelled. Avoid excessive deaeration time to prevent premature curing of the silicone.Brushing or Pouring: Brushing: For master molds with complex structures, the brushing method is often used. Apply a layer of silicone to the master mold surface, allow it to partially dry, then apply subsequent layers. If needed, embed gauze or fiberglass cloth between layers to enhance mold strength.Pouring: For master molds with simple shapes and smooth surfaces, the pouring method is suitable. Slowly pour the deaerated silicone into the master mold, ensuring it fills all areas without trapping air bubbles.Curing: After brushing or pouring, allow the silicone to cure naturally at room temperature. Curing time varies depending on the silicone type and ambient temperature, generally ranging from several hours to dozens of hours. Avoid touching or moving the mold during curing to prevent distortion or loss of precision.Demolding: Once the silicone has fully cured, carefully remove the mold from the master mold. For brushed molds, first gently peel off the outer gauze or fiberglass cloth, then separate the silicone mold from the master. For poured molds, simply demold by removing the silicone directly. more>

Excessive degassing time may cause premature curing, affecting the quality of the silicone.Principles of Pad Printing Pad Manufacturing:a.; The vulcanization system of rubber is the foundation of significant advancements in the rubber industry. Pad printing pads are made using the principle of room-temperature vulcanized silicone rubber cross-linking into a network-structured elastomer under the action of vulcanizing agents.b.; Rubber consists of large molecular chain hydrocarbons. Rubber with only carbon atoms in the main chain is called carbon-chain rubber; rubber with other atoms besides carbon in the main chain is called heterochain rubber. If the main chain contains organic groups with atoms like silicon (Si), tin (Sn), or boron (B), it is termed an elemental organic polymer. Silicone rubber is an elemental organic polymer with organosilicon groups in its main chain. There are two vulcanization processes for silicone rubber: high-temperature vulcanization, corresponding to high-temperature vulcanized silicone rubber (HTV), and room-temperature vulcanization, corresponding to room-temperature vulcanized silicone rubber (RTV). RTV silicone rubber is further divided into addition-type and condensation-type.c.; Condensation-type silicone rubber contains terminal hydroxyl groups (-OH), which easily react with silanes containing hydrolyzable groups (-OCH3, -OCOCH3) for room-temperature vulcanization. The cross-linking agent is ethyl silicate, and the catalyst is dibutyltin dilaurate. Addition-type silicone rubber typically contains -CH=CH terminal groups and usually uses polysiloxane with Si-H bonds as a cross-linking agent for self-addition reactions to form an elastomer.  more>

Product Description: Optical cover glass (Cover Glass/Cover Lens) serves as the "outer armor" of display and touch systems and is the first gateway in the imaging light path. It is typically made of ultra-thin soda-lime or high-aluminum-silicon glass, ranging from 0.3 mm to 2 mm in thickness. Through processes such as cutting, CNC shaping, chemical strengthening (CS > 450 MPa, DOL > 8 μm), thinning, polishing, coating, and screen printing, it maintains a visible light transmittance of ≥92% while endowing the glass with composite properties such as drop resistance, scratch resistance, anti-glare, anti-reflection, fingerprint resistance, and resistance to acids and alkalis.Depending on terminal requirements, cover glass can be layered with functional coatings such as AG (anti-glare), AR (anti-reflection), AF (oleophobic), UV-IR Cut, light-shielding ink (BM), and stray light absorption layers to achieve high contrast, high color reproduction, low fingerprint residue, and long-term weather resistance. It can also undergo 3D hot bending or etching thinning to achieve curves with a radius of over R500 mm at a thickness of 0.1 mm, meeting the stringent demands of foldable screens, automotive HUDs, and wearable devices for lightness, thinness, flexibility, and safety. more>
